Assab Steels 8407 SUPREME Hot Work Steel
Categories: Metal; Ferrous Metal; Chrome-moly Steel; Tool Steel; Hot Work Steel

Material Notes: 8407 SUPREME is characterized by:
  • High level of resistance to thermal shock and thermal fatigue
  • Good high temperature strength
  • Excellent toughness and ductility in all directions
  • Good machinability and polishability
  • Excellent through-hardening properties
  • Good dimensional stability during hardening

The name "SUPREME" implies that by special processing techniques and close control, the steel attains high purity and a very fine structure. Further, 8407 SUPREME shows significant improvements in isotropic properties compared to conventionally produced AISI H 13 grades.

These improved isotropic properties are particularly valuable for tooling subjected to high mechanical and thermal fatigue stresses, e.g. die casting dies, forging tools and extrusion tooling. In practical terms, tools may be used at somewhat higher working hardness (+1 to 2 HRC without loss of toughness. Since increased hardness slows down the formation of heatchecking cracks, improved tool performance can be expected.

8407 SUPREME meets the North American Die Casting Association (NADCA) #207-90 for premium high quality H-13 die steel.

Applications: Tools for Die casting: Dies, fixed inserts cores, sprue parts, nozzles, ejector pins (nitrided), plunger, shot-sleeve (normally nitrided).
Tools for Extrusion: Dies, backers, die holders, liners, dummy blocks, stems.
Tools for pressing Aluminum, magnesium, copper alloys, and steel.
Molds for plastics: Injection molds, compression/transfer molds.

Premium AISI H13, W.-Nr. 1.2344
